Refund For Broken Appliance

If a household appliance such as a washing machine, fridge, oven, or dishwasher breaks unexpectedly, you may have rights under UK consumer law. Depending on the circumstances, you may be entitled to a repair, replacement, or refund.

Why appliance refund disputes happen

Appliance disputes often occur when a retailer directs the customer to the manufacturer for a repair instead of handling the issue themselves.

Under UK consumer law, however, the retailer is responsible for resolving problems with faulty goods. If the appliance fails unexpectedly or develops faults early, your rights may support repair, replacement, or refund depending on the situation.

What you can do next

Record the issue

Take photos or videos showing the appliance fault and note when the problem first appeared.

Keep purchase evidence

Save receipts, order confirmations, delivery records, and any communication with the retailer.

Escalate the complaint

If the retailer refuses to resolve the issue, you may need to escalate the dispute formally.
